1. Overview of the Keene, NH Job Market
The job market in Keene, NH, is diverse, with opportunities in healthcare, manufacturing, education, and retail. The city's economy is supported by a mix of local businesses and larger regional employers. Understanding the market trends can help you focus your job search effectively.
- Key Industries: Healthcare, Manufacturing, Education, Retail
 - Major Employers: Cheshire Medical Center, Markem-Imaje, Keene State College

4. Tips for Your Job Search
Resume Optimization
A well-crafted resume is crucial. Highlight your skills and experience relevant to the jobs you're applying for.
- Bullet Points: Use bullet points to list your accomplishments and responsibilities.
 - Keywords: Incorporate keywords from the job descriptions.
 - Experience: Focus on your most recent and relevant experience.
 
Cover Letter
A compelling cover letter can set you apart. Tailor your cover letter to each job application, explaining why you're a good fit for the role and the company.
- First-Person Insights: "In my experience, a personalized cover letter shows the employer you're genuinely interested in the position."
 - Value Proposition: Clearly state how you can contribute to the company.
 
Interview Preparation
Prepare for interviews by researching the company and practicing common interview questions.
- STAR Method: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ers.
 - Company Research: Understand the company's mission, values, and recent news.
